I need a set of belts for the 12” table saw blade on my MM ST4 saw. The scoring blade and shaper belts are fine. It has three v pulleys on the spindle but there is one belt still in place and another shredded. Does anyone know if it should have a three belt set or are only two of the pulleys used? Anyone know where to source a replacement set? Sorry my manual is packed away in my rented storage and not immediately accessible.

Actually two of the three belts are shredded. It appears that the belt tensioner lock bolt had come loose, likely the cause of the problem.

I used to own a Minimax Sc2 saw that I fixed up and sold. I needed a new drive belt for that saw and ordered it through my local NAPA parts store. I took the remains of the old one in ,it was a metric size belt . I think if you need three just order three, the "matched set" thing seems to have become a moot point nowadays.

Any V-belt of the correct length should work fine. Grainger, auto parts places, etc. The measurements should be printed on the belt itself. The only oddball is the scoring drive belt, which is is this flat band-type belt. Hope this helps.
